  5. From News24... British baker Warburtons posed the question "What are your top three cheesiest moments in film?" to 2000 UK moviegoers in celebration of the launch of their new cheese-flavoured crumpets. The list of big cheese moments: (1) Titanic: Leonardo DiCaprio's "I'm the king of the world!" (2) Dirty Dancing: Patrick Swayze's "Nobody puts Baby in the corner." (3) Four Weddings And A Funeral: Andie McDowell's "Is it still raining? I hadn't noticed." (4) Ghost: Demi Moore's "Ditto," to Patrick Swayze's "I love you." (5) Top Gun: Val Kilmer to Tom Cruise: "You can be my wingman anytime" (6) Notting Hill: Julia Roberts' "I'm just a girl ... standing in front of a boy ... asking him to love her." (7) Independence Day: Bill Pullman's "Today we celebrate our Independence Day!" (8) Braveheart: Mel Gibson's "They may take our lives, but they will not take our freedom!" (9) Jerry Maguire: Renee Zellweger to Tom Cruise: "You had me at hello." (10) The Postman: A blind woman says to Kevin Costner: "You're a godsend, a saviour." He replies: "No, I'm a postman."     I do dont nearly as much Web work as I used to but I always liked UltraEdit. I hate "intelligent" editors that like to insert their own crap in for you in places. UltraEdit color codes the tags, comments and script texts, only stores what you type, and is useful for so much more than just HTML editing. - No 'mericans were harmed during the making of this post.
